Answer:
7.5 sec.
Explanation:
A = A₀e⁻^kt => k = ln(A/A₀)/-t => ln(6.25/100)/-30s = 0.0924 s⁻¹
k·t₀.₅=0.693 => t₀.₅=0.693/k = (0.693/0.0924)s = 7.5 s
